小编Ear*_*arl的帖子

执行数组动态初始化时的操作顺序

我浏览了dcl.init.aggr部分并找不到明确的答案.

考虑:

static int x[2] = { f(), g() };
Run Code Online (Sandbox Code Playgroud)

标准是否说首先被初始化:x [0]或x [1]?

换句话说,哪个函数首先运行:f()或g()?

c++ initialization

7
推荐指数
2
解决办法
121
查看次数

标签 统计

c++ ×1

initialization ×1